Driving without securing their children in the car.<\/p>\n<p>In a new campaign &#8211; &#8220;Buckle-Up or Face-Up!&#8221; &#8211; the Jumeirah nursery is targeting parents who drop off or pick up children without buckling them into safety seats or seat belts.<\/p>\n<p>The first time, staff post the car registration number on a nursery bulletin board. The second time, they post the child&#8217;s name under the heading &#8220;Child at Risk.&#8221;<\/p>\n<p>&#8220;So far, when they&#8217;ve been caught they haven&#8217;t done it again,&#8221; said the nursery manager, Elizabeth Hart. &#8220;They&#8217;ve been too embarrassed.&#8221;<\/p>\n<p>The Government has been discussing making child car restraints obligatory since 2008, but failing to secure young children is not yet illegal.<\/p>\n<p>A Ministry of Interior official told Al Ittihad newspaper this month that they were renewing their efforts to codify the safety practice.<\/p>\n<p>Five children died and 134 were injured in traffic accidents in the first half of this year.<\/p>\n<p>&#8220;Almost always when we have children injured, they are unrestrained, and they did not use seat belts or they were sitting in the front seat,&#8221; said DrTaisserAtrak, chair of pediatrics at Mafraq Hospital.<\/p>\n<p>A YouGovSiraj survey last year found that 30 per cent of parents did not use car seats for children under 1 and 35 per cent did not use them for children aged 1 to 4.<\/p>\n<p>Instead of waiting for a law, Beautiful Minds Nurseries founder Bernadette King-Turner decided to take matters into her own hands.<\/p>\n<p>&#8220;A lot of children are now being fastened in the vehicle because the parents are like, &#8216;Ms Bernadette is going to catch me&#8217;,&#8221; she said. &#8220;They don&#8217;t want to be shamed. They want to show that they&#8217;re doing the right thing with their children.&#8221;<\/p>\n<p>The Dubai nursery chain announced the policy in a note to parents at the start of the term. It applies to all four of its nurseries: Emerald City, Yellow Brick Road, Crystal Valley and Indigo Valley.<\/p>\n<p>&#8220;I have nearly 800 children at the nurseries,&#8221; Ms King-Turner said. &#8220;There&#8217;s a good number of children we can keep safe, and hopefully the parents of those children will not let them be in the front seat or on their driver&#8217;s lap or just running freely through the vehicle.&#8221;<\/p>\n<p>At Emerald City, a security guard watches drop-offs and pick-ups and discreetly notes the details of offenders.<\/p>\n<p>The nursery, which has more than 100 children, has caught 11 families since monitoring began on September 12 &#8211; six in the first two days. Ms Hart gives the parent a warning card the next time they arrive.<\/p>\n<p>&#8220;It&#8217;s not always the parent, sometimes it&#8217;s the driver, sometimes the taxi driver,&#8221; said Ms King-Turner. &#8220;Sometimes the parents are not aware.&#8221;<\/p>\n<p>The policy has been welcomed by parents.<\/p>\n<p>&#8220;In Mexico it&#8217;s compulsory,&#8221; said Adriana Salinas, from Mexico and mother of two-year-old Pablo.<\/p>\n<p>&#8220;It&#8217;s a really good initiative,&#8221; said Nada Labib, from Egypt, mother of three-year-old Layla. &#8220;Parents don&#8217;t take it seriously. They think sometimes, it&#8217;s only a short trip.&#8221;<\/p>\n<p>AntheaModin, from South Africa, mother of two-year-old Thalia, has &#8220;always been a big supporter of buckling up.<\/p>\n<p>&#8220;My oldest son is 8 and of course we have the argument about, &#8216;I&#8217;m big,&#8217; but for us it&#8217;s a no-no.&#8221;<\/p>\n<p>She called over her son, Trond, and asked his opinion. He gravely agreed with her. &#8220;Kids could die,&#8221; Trond said.<\/p>\n<p>DrAtrak praised the nursery&#8217;s campaign. &#8220;Unless we work as a team everywhere in the community \u2026 we will not make much difference.&#8221;<\/p>\n<p>Education and legislation must go hand-in-hand, he said. &#8220;Legislation alone would not do much, because parents would just ignore it. But if we tell them the right message, then they will.&#8221;<\/p>\n<p>&nbsp;<\/p>\n","protected":false},"excerpt":{"rendered":"<p>&nbsp; It&#8217;s been one week since Emerald City Nursery started tracking offenders, and they already have 11 embarrassed families on a watch-list.
